Charles Stephens Funeral Directors Charles Stephens is Wirral’s largest and longest established funeral directors, with a proud history dating back to 1896.

We have an extensive network of branches and chapels of rest across the peninsula and offer 24-hour support, seven days a week. Charles Stephens is the Wirral’s largest and longest established funeral directors, dating back to 1896. A fourth-generation family owned business, we are wholly committed to providing you with the very best funeral care,

Our nine funeral homes, situated across Wirral, are specifically designed to cater for all your needs with comfort, dignity and respect. Each and every member of our team is trained to the highest level and we support the attainment of relevant professional qualifications at all levels. When called upon to undertake a funeral it is our policy at Charles Stephens, to take complete responsibility for all the details involved. We are able to pre-arrange funerals and take your instructions now and hold them until such a time as they are needed. This saves any difficult discussions within the family and gives you peace of mind knowing everything will take place in accordance with your wishes.

Looking for a sign 🕊

In the quiet moments after losing someone we love, many of us find ourselves searching for comfort. Sometimes that comfort can come in the form of signs, a robin appearing or something small that feels like more than a coincidence.

Many of us feel that seeing a robin after losing a loved one is a quiet sign that they are still near. These little birds often show up at the right moment, when we need that little reminder or reassurance.

It's not just robins either, some take comfort in hearing that certain song on the radio or a white feather on the path.

These small moments can bring a surprising sense of peace at times when we need it most. 🫶
